对 Kubernetes 有了原生的支持,可以通过服务发现的形式来自动监控集群,因此我们可以使用另外一种更加高级的方式来部署 ...
前言 redis deployment 是 kubernetes 外面的 redis 从。prometheus 是通过 redis exporter 监控 redis 的。 redis exporter 和 redis 是部署在一个 pod 里面的。本文中用到的 prometheus operator 中的 CustomResource 有 prometheus podmonitors。如下: 监 ...
2019-12-20 15:24 0 824 推荐指数:
对 Kubernetes 有了原生的支持,可以通过服务发现的形式来自动监控集群,因此我们可以使用另外一种更加高级的方式来部署 ...
什么是Operator Operator是由 CoreOS 公司开发的,用来扩展 Kubernetes API,特定的应用程序控制器。它被用来创建、配置和管理复杂的有状态应用,如数据库、缓存和监控系统。Operator 是基于 Kubernetes 的资源和控制器概念之上构建 ...
1.创建命名空间 新建一个yaml文件命名为monitor-namespace.yaml,写入如下内容: 执行如下命令创建monitoring命名空间: 2.创建ClusterRole 你需要对上面创建的命名空间分配集群的读取权限,以便Prometheus ...
使用Prometheus监控Kubernetes集群 监控方面Grafana采用YUM安装通过服务形式运行,部署在Master上,而Prometheus则通过POD运行,Grafana通过使用Prometheus的service地址来获取数据源。 Prometheus的配置清单 ...
Kubernetes为Google开源的容器管理框架,提供了Docker容器的夸主机、集群管理、容器部署、高可用、弹性伸缩等一系列功能;Kubernetes的设计目标包括使容器集群任意时刻都处于用户期望的状态,因而建立了一整套集群管理机制:容器自动重启、自动备份、容器自动伸缩 ...
部署在kubernetes中,以NFS作为数据存储卷 环境介绍: 名称 版本 K8S v1.17.2 Docker 19.03.5 nacos ...
副本集结构 注意: 1、安装mongodb_exporter可以不在仲裁节点安装,仲裁节点设置的用户名密码是无法使用的,若仲裁节点没有安装,监控中mongodb_up是无法显示,只会显示主从的值 2、启动方式建议使用第二种,第二种mongo_up可以查看主从的值 ...